Output dbde70e407064cfd5a7ad3924419557199c9cc9eac483918d1ae9c2be741cfaf:29

value
8001363
script pubkey
OP_0 OP_PUSHBYTES_20 d5283024a0dba6d05e3567a845d359be29f40f82
address
bc1q655rqf9qmwndqh34v75yt56ehc5lgruzyk9egy
transaction
dbde70e407064cfd5a7ad3924419557199c9cc9eac483918d1ae9c2be741cfaf
confirmations
252064
spent
true